On april 4, 1996, regulations were adopted under the ontario employment standards act in order, among other things, to exempt a successor employer from its obligation to comply with the termination of employment provisions of part xiv of the act if the employer doe s not employ an employee of the previous employer. Protection of young persons employment act, 1996 note on employing a child by licence under section 32 theatre licence section 32 of the protection of young persons employment act, 1996 allows the minister to authorise, by licence, in individual cases, the employment of a child.
